securecrt中文乱码(securecrt中文乱码怎么办已经设置UTF-8)
时间: 2023-10-15 14:25:25 浏览: 630
对于SecureCRT中文乱码的问题,你可以尝试以下步骤进行解决:
1. 确保你的SecureCRT已经设置为UTF-8编码。在SecureCRT中,你可以选择"Options" -> "Session Options" -> "Terminal" -> "Appearance" -> "Character encoding",选择UTF-8作为默认编码。
2. 检查你所连接的远程设备的字符编码设置。有时候,远程设备可能使用不同的字符编码,导致乱码问题。你可以尝试手动设置远程设备的字符编码来匹配SecureCRT的设置。
3. 如果仍然遇到乱码问题,尝试在SecureCRT中手动更改一些终端设置。在SecureCRT中,选择"Options" -> "Session Options" -> "Terminal" -> "Emulation",尝试不同的终端类型(如VT100、xterm)来查看是否能解决乱码问题。
4. 最后,如果以上步骤都没有解决问题,你可以尝试升级SecureCRT到最新版本,或者联系SecureCRT的官方支持团队获取更多帮助。
希望以上方法能帮助你解决SecureCRT中文乱码的问题!如果还有其他问题,请随时提问。
相关问题
securecrt汉字乱码
### 解决 SecureCRT 汉字乱码问题的方法
#### 字符编码设置
为了确保字符能够被正确解析,在SecureCRT中应调整字符编码设置。具体操作是在菜单栏选择「选项」,接着点击「会话选项」,进入「外观」分类下的「字符编码」部分,这里应当把编码方式设定为`UTF-8`格式[^2]。
#### 更改字体配置
除了编码外,使用的字体也会影响中文能否正常呈现。同样地,在「选项-会话选项-外观」路径下找到「标准字体」设置项,挑选一款支持中文渲染的字体样式,例如楷体或其他适合显示CJK(中日韩)文字的字体。
#### 验证服务器端环境变量
考虑到客户端和服务端之间的交互可能引发兼容性问题,确认目标主机上的locale环境是否已适配多语言处理也很重要。对于Linux系统而言,可以通过命令行查看当前的语言和地区设置:
```bash
echo $LANG
```
理想情况下,该值应该指向一种包含了Unicode支持的语言包版本,像`zh_CN.UTF-8`这样的字符串表示中国地区并采用UTF-8作为内部编码方案[^4]。
通过上述措施可以有效改善甚至彻底消除SecureCRT中的汉字乱码现象,从而获得更好的用户体验和工作效率提升。
securecrt中文乱码怎么办
在 SecureCRT 中遇到中文乱码问题,可以尝试以下几个解决方法:
1. 确保 SecureCRT 的字符编码设置正确:
- 打开 SecureCRT,点击菜单栏的 "Options"(选项)-> "Global Options"(全局选项)。
- 在左侧的树状菜单中选择 "Session"(会话)-> "Appearance"(外观)-> "Character encoding"(字符编码)。
- 确保选择了正确的字符编码,例如 UTF-8 或者 GBK。
2. 检查远程服务器的字符编码设置:
- 在 SecureCRT 中连接到远程服务器后,可以尝试执行命令 `locale` 查看当前的语言环境和字符编码设置。
- 如果字符编码设置不正确,可以使用命令 `export LANG=<正确的字符编码>` 来修改字符编码。
- 如果是 Linux 系统,可以编辑 `/etc/default/locale` 文件来设置默认的语言环境和字符编码。
3. 调整 SecureCRT 的字体设置:
- 点击菜单栏的 "Options"(选项)-> "Global Options"(全局选项)。
- 在左侧的树状菜单中选择 "Session"(会话)-> "Appearance"(外观)-> "Fonts"(字体)。
- 尝试选择不同的字体,并确保所选字体支持中文字符。
4. 尝试使用其他终端软件:
- 如果以上方法都无效,可以尝试使用其他终端软件,例如 Xshell、PuTTY 等,看是否能够正常显示中文字符。
希望以上方法能够帮助你解决 SecureCRT 中文乱码的问题!如果还有其他疑问,请随时提问。
阅读全文
相关推荐














